1301 Surf Ave. by Benet Dalmau Alsina, Oil on canvas, 2024

Selected for the 2025 London Art Biennale, Spain. Oil on canvas, 2024. 154x105x5cm.

1301 Surf Ave. is part of a series of realistic cityscape paintings that, through the chaos and order of temporary elements like scaffolding, graffiti, or vegetation, seek a connection between the natural landscape and the urban environment. The work aims to convey the involuntary natural expression of these places — a kind of white noise emerging from the harsher, more disconnected urban spaces.

Artist working across painting, photography, and architectural visualization. This self-taught artist creates works that explore the relationship between urban and natural spaces. His vision, shaped by color blindness and dyslexia, offers a unique reading of light, color, and form. He has been awarded or selected in competitions such as the BBA Artist Prize, ARC Salon Competition, Fondazione Modigliani, Tartget Painting Prize, Figurativas (MEAM).
